当前位置:首页 / EXCEL

对数在Excel中怎么用?如何快速计算?

作者:佚名|分类:EXCEL|浏览:75|发布时间:2025-04-15 19:15:44

对数在Excel中怎么用?如何快速计算?

在数据处理和统计分析中,对数是一个非常重要的数学工具。Excel作为一款广泛使用的电子表格软件,内置了对数函数,使得用户可以轻松地在Excel中进行对数计算。本文将详细介绍如何在Excel中使用对数函数,并分享一些快速计算对数的技巧。

一、Excel中对数函数的基本用法

Excel中常用的对数函数主要有两个:`LOG`和`LN`。

1. `LOG`函数

`LOG(number, [base])`:返回给定数字的以指定底数为底的对数。

参数说明:

`number`:需要求对数的数字。

`[base]`:对数的底数,默认为10。

2. `LN`函数

`LN(number)`:返回给定数字的自然对数,即以`e`(自然对数的底数)为底的对数。

二、对数函数的示例

以下是一个使用`LOG`和`LN`函数的示例:

假设我们有一个数据集,包含以下数值:

```

A B

1 10

2 100

3 1000

```

我们需要计算每个数值的以10为底的对数和自然对数。

1. 以10为底的对数:

在C1单元格中输入公式:`=LOG(A1, 10)`,按回车键得到结果1。

在C2单元格中输入公式:`=LOG(A2, 10)`,按回车键得到结果2。

在C3单元格中输入公式:`=LOG(A3, 10)`,按回车键得到结果3。

2. 自然对数:

在D1单元格中输入公式:`=LN(A1)`,按回车键得到结果2.30258509299。

在D2单元格中输入公式:`=LN(A2)`,按回车键得到结果4.60517018599。

在D3单元格中输入公式:`=LN(A3)`,按回车键得到结果6.90775527898。

三、如何快速计算对数

1. 使用数组公式

当需要对一个数值范围进行对数计算时,可以使用数组公式来提高效率。

例如,假设我们有一个数值范围在A列,从A1到A10,我们需要计算这些数值的自然对数。

在B1单元格中输入公式:`=LN(A1:A10)`,按Ctrl+Shift+Enter组合键,Excel会自动将公式转换为数组公式,并返回B1到B10单元格的结果。

2. 使用数据透视表

如果需要对大量数据进行对数计算,可以使用数据透视表功能。

在数据透视表中,将需要计算对数的字段拖拽到“值”区域,然后选择“值字段设置”,在“数值格式”中选择“对数”。

四、相关问答

1. 问题:对数函数的底数可以是负数吗?

回答:不可以。对数函数的底数必须大于0且不等于1。

2. 问题:如何计算以任意底数为底的对数?

回答:可以使用换底公式:`LOG(number, base) = LN(number) / LN(base)`。

3. 问题:对数函数在Excel中是否支持复数?

回答:不支持。对数函数只适用于实数。

4. 问题:如何避免对数函数计算结果为错误值?

回答:确保输入的数值大于0,且底数大于0且不等于1。

通过以上内容,相信您已经掌握了在Excel中使用对数函数的方法和技巧。在实际应用中,灵活运用这些方法,可以大大提高数据处理和分析的效率。